Output 84ab83baa5d3d0d45c5c7d6c662a1ebe0480f570e4466bed9ada988160b8d6dc:3

value
159760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028cdcac110f4f0e5500f24191157cd2e7c39500 OP_EQUAL
address
31vW2C25nQ8gHE4dfH24gbzjekRdAfv6EV
transaction
84ab83baa5d3d0d45c5c7d6c662a1ebe0480f570e4466bed9ada988160b8d6dc